New post on the trunk flood, 2 new leaks found 200 1992

Besides the gaping hole at the top of the rear LH splash guard to the spare tire compartment, I found two more leaks.

Second leak:
The rear side window appears to be leaking when I sprayed it with water. The black painted chrome trim is fastened with three rivets and it has to come off. I expect to find a rust hole in the corner.

Any tips for the R&R of the trim?

Third leak:
I knew this would be a problem sooner or later. Some bubbling paint in the corner below the rear window at the LH side. The hole is in the gutter next to the trunk gasket.

I an investment in Por 15 is needed.
